To ensure that the contents in the NICE design system are of high quality they need to meet a certain standard.

What we look for in a proposal

The design system team will review whether a proposal is unique and useful.

Unique

The component/pattern/other does not already exist in the NICE Design System.

If the proposal is a change to an existing component or pattern, then it should be an improvement on what we currently have.

Useful

There is evidence the component or pattern meets user or business needs.

Developing a component or pattern

During development, a component or pattern will be assessed against these criteria to ensure it is suitable to be published into the NICE design system.

Usable

User research shows the component/pattern is easy to use or solves a usability issue(s).

Impactful

The component or pattern can add value to the organisation.

Versatile

The component or pattern can be used for multiple NICE services and products.

Consistent

Existing styles/foundations can be used to design and develop the component or pattern.

Feasible

It is technically feasible for the component to be developed in an accessible way to ensure we develop components everybody can use.
